WHAT IS MONKEYPOX?
Monkeypox or Mpox is caused by the Monkeypox virus from the Poxvirus family where the virus that causes smallpox belong.
The virus spreads from close contact with infected persons, through touch, kissing or s*x. From contact with infected materials such as contaminated sheets or clothes.
It can also be acquired from direct contact with infected wild animals, when hunting, skinning or cooking them.
Mpox causes signs & symptoms which usually begins within a week, but can start 1-21 days after exposure to the virus. Symptoms typically lasts 2-4 weeks, but may last longer in someone with a weakened immune system.
Most common symptoms are: rash, fever, sorethroat, headache, muscle aches, back pain, low energy, swollen lymph nodes. Mpox rash begins as a flat sore which develops into a blister filled with fluid and maybe itchy or painful. As the rash heals, the lesions dry up, crust over & fall off. Lesions can be anywhere in the body: palms of the hands, soles of the feet, face, scalp, mouth, throat, groin, ge***al areas, a**s.
People with Mpox are highly contagious & can pass the disease to others until all sores are healed & a new layer of skin has formed.
Monkeypox is checked through antibody (PCR) test of the skin lesion.
What to do when infected with Mpox:
- stay at home & isolate
- wash hand often & sanitize especially after touching a sore
- wear a mask & cover lesions especially when around other people
- avoid touching items in shared spaces
- use salt water gargle for sores in the mouth
- do NOT pop blisters
- do shave areas with sores until scabs have healed
Currently there is no treatment approved specifically for Monkeypox. Supportive care & pain control is sufficient if you have an intact immune system & don’t have skin disease (eczema can cause uncontrolled viral spread). If you’re very sick or with severe complications from the Mpox, your Doctor will prescribe an anti-viral drug.

Dengue mosquitoes like to breed in uncovered or unused containers that collect water like water tanks, bottles, tins, tyres, drums & coconut shells.
Remove these objects from inside & outside your house.
Drain, wash & scrub water storage containers every week & cover them.

Prolonged screen or reading times can lead to eye strain, dry eyes, and headaches. DO ✅ take breaks! Use the 20 - 20 - 20 rule to help your eyes:
🖥️ After using a screen for 20 minutes
📏 Look at an object 20 feet away
🕓 For 20 seconds
